001// --------------------------------------------------------------------------------
002// Copyright 2002-2024 Echo Three, LLC
003//
004// Licensed under the Apache License, Version 2.0 (the "License");
005// you may not use this file except in compliance with the License.
006// You may obtain a copy of the License at
007//
008//     http://www.apache.org/licenses/LICENSE-2.0
009//
010// Unless required by applicable law or agreed to in writing, software
011// distributed under the License is distributed on an "AS IS" BASIS,
012// W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
013// See the License for the specific language governing permissions and
014// limitations under the License.
015// --------------------------------------------------------------------------------
016
017package com.echothree.model.control.security.common.transfer;
018
019import com.echothree.model.control.security.common.transfer.SecurityRoleGroupTransfer;
020import com.echothree.util.common.transfer.BaseTransfer;
021
022public class SecurityRoleGroupResultTransfer
023        extends BaseTransfer {
024    
025    private String securityRoleGroupName;
026    private SecurityRoleGroupTransfer securityRoleGroup;
027    
028    /** Creates a new instance of SecurityRoleGroupResultTransfer */
029    public SecurityRoleGroupResultTransfer(String securityRoleGroupName, SecurityRoleGroupTransfer securityRoleGroup) {
030        this.securityRoleGroupName = securityRoleGroupName;
031        this.securityRoleGroup = securityRoleGroup;
032    }
033
034    /**
035     * Returns the securityRoleGroupName.
036     * @return the securityRoleGroupName
037     */
038    public String getSecurityRoleGroupName() {
039        return securityRoleGroupName;
040    }
041
042    /**
043     * Sets the securityRoleGroupName.
044     * @param securityRoleGroupName the securityRoleGroupName to set
045     */
046    public void setSecurityRoleGroupName(String securityRoleGroupName) {
047        this.securityRoleGroupName = securityRoleGroupName;
048    }
049
050    /**
051     * Returns the securityRoleGroup.
052     * @return the securityRoleGroup
053     */
054    public SecurityRoleGroupTransfer getSecurityRoleGroup() {
055        return securityRoleGroup;
056    }
057
058    /**
059     * Sets the securityRoleGroup.
060     * @param securityRoleGroup the securityRoleGroup to set
061     */
062    public void setSecurityRoleGroup(SecurityRoleGroupTransfer securityRoleGroup) {
063        this.securityRoleGroup = securityRoleGroup;
064    }
065
066 }